Athas case:Next hearing on May 15

The Court of Appeal postponed the hearing of the case where two Air Force Officers were sentenced by the Colombo High Court for illegal trespassing on the residence of, and intimidating using firearms, The Sunday Times Defence Correspondent Iqbal Athas.

The two accused Rukman Herath and Don Pradeep Sujeewa Kannangara were found guilty on two counts and sentenced to seven years rigorous imprisonment on the first count and two years on the second count and fined Rs. 10.000 with one year added to the sentence in case the fine was not paid.

The first accused Rukman Herath was killed during the proceedings and was represented by his father. President’s Counsel Ranjith Abeysuriya appearing for both accused informed court that they were innocent and were not present at Mr. Athas’s residence.

He said the people who had come there were in search of women and as they were informed in the negative they went away
The Judges of the Court of Appeal M. Immam and Sarath de Abrew said that the case would be resumed on May 15.
